A Life-Changing Decision After 30 Years of Marriage — A Heartfelt Story

On the morning that should have marked our thirtieth wedding anniversary, I made a decision that changed both of our lives: I asked my husband, Zack, for a divorce. To him, it felt sudden and shocking, but he didn’t see the years of quiet unhappiness I had been carrying. Once our youngest child moved out, the silence in our home forced me to confront the emotions I had buried for decades.

When Zack asked why, I tried to explain with honesty and kindness. He wasn’t unfaithful or unkind, yet during the hardest chapters of our lives—the exhaustion of parenting, the stress of work, the loss of my father, my health struggles—he was emotionally absent. Not cruel, just unreachable. My attempts to connect, my requests for support, even counseling, were dismissed because he believed nothing was wrong.

Leaving wasn’t anger—it was survival. I moved into a small, sunlit apartment near the beach, rebuilt my routines, rediscovered joy, and felt myself breathe again. My children noticed the change immediately. And months later, I met Sam—a gentle, steady man who listens, shows up, and brings peace. Looking back, I don’t regret the past, but choosing growth saved me. Sometimes letting go is the first step toward the life you deserve.
